Output 12f96f21b880e77bed4a47d4e8fbdd7bac3479ca1da552e5690c8deb6a481e00:0

value
610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ad9e4cf0c44720bca2e97c6cb027f5c1ca2360a OP_EQUAL
address
39yPmLKxaKQtvdFBxt81WzqiP8TWfaKvXd
transaction
12f96f21b880e77bed4a47d4e8fbdd7bac3479ca1da552e5690c8deb6a481e00
confirmations
171070
spent
true